The Age of Overstimulation and Information Overload
We live in a world that is characterized by constant connectivity. From morning to night, most individuals are immersed in a continuous flow of digital information. According to a study by the Pew Research Center, the average American spends more than 10 hours per day interacting with screens, including computers, smartphones, tablets, and televisions (Pew Research Center, 2019). This screen time has skyrocketed in recent years, driven by the rise of social media, the ubiquity of smartphones, and the need for constant availability in both personal and professional contexts.
The concept of “overstimulation” refers to the overwhelming flood of sensory input and emotional engagement that comes with the relentless consumption of digital media. This continuous interaction with devices can create a state of mental fatigue, leaving individuals feeling drained, distracted, and unable to focus on tasks at hand. In extreme cases, this overstimulation can lead to cognitive overload, where the brain is no longer able to process information effectively. The average person is bombarded with an endless stream of notifications, emails, messages, advertisements, and updates, leading to a state of mental clutter.
The Cognitive Load of Constant Connectivity
Cognitive load refers to the total amount of mental effort required to process information. In an era of constant digital engagement, the cognitive load has increased dramatically. Smartphones, social media, and work-related apps demand our attention on a constant basis, dividing our focus and preventing deep thinking. Studies have shown that multitasking, particularly when it involves switching between various digital tasks, can impair memory and decrease the brain’s ability to process information efficiently (Ophir, Nass, & Wagner, 2009). As we juggle multiple tasks at once—such as checking emails, responding to text messages, scrolling through social media, and listening to podcasts—we place a heavy load on our working memory, making it harder to concentrate on any single task for an extended period.
The concept of “continuous partial attention” (CPA), coined by Linda Stone in the early 2000s, refers to the state of being perpetually alert and distracted, without fully focusing on any one thing. This phenomenon is particularly prevalent in individuals who regularly check their phones and multitask throughout the day. While CPA allows us to stay connected and responsive, it comes at the cost of mental clarity and focus. Studies have suggested that constant distractions can lead to increased stress levels, anxiety, and difficulty in completing tasks (McMillan & MacKay, 2020).
The Impact of Social Media on Mental Health
Social media platforms like Facebook, Instagram, Twitter, and TikTok have become primary sources of entertainment and information for millions of people. While these platforms facilitate communication and foster social connections, they also contribute to feelings of inadequacy, stress, and anxiety. Research has shown that excessive use of social media is linked to a variety of negative mental health outcomes, including depression, loneliness, and low self-esteem (Fuchs, 2017). The curated nature of social media—where people post only the best aspects of their lives—can create unrealistic expectations and lead to feelings of comparison and social envy.
Moreover, the addictive nature of social media algorithms, designed to keep users engaged for as long as possible, exacerbates the problem. The constant checking of notifications, scrolling through feeds, and seeking validation through likes and comments can create a cycle of dependency that is difficult to break. This contributes to a state of constant overstimulation, where the brain is repeatedly rewarded with small bursts of dopamine, further reinforcing the cycle of digital engagement.
Understanding the Science Behind Digital Detoxing
Digital detoxing involves intentionally disconnecting from digital devices and online platforms for a specified period. The goal is to allow the brain to reset, reduce stress, and improve overall mental well-being. But why does taking a break from technology seem to have such a profound effect on our cognitive functioning?
Neuroplasticity and the Brain’s Ability to Rewire Itself
One of the key reasons digital detoxing can be effective in resetting the brain is due to the concept of neuroplasticity. Neuroplasticity refers to the brain’s ability to reorganize itself by forming new neural connections in response to experiences and environmental stimuli. Just as the brain adapts to new information and learning, it can also rewire itself in response to changes in behavior, such as reducing the amount of time spent interacting with digital devices.
When individuals engage in constant digital media consumption, their brains become accustomed to fast-paced information processing and short bursts of attention. Over time, this can lead to difficulties in focusing on slower, more sustained tasks. However, when a person takes time off from screens, the brain can recalibrate and reestablish the ability to focus for longer periods, which is essential for tasks requiring deep thought and creativity.
Studies have shown that regular engagement in mindfulness practices, which are often part of a digital detox, can also promote neuroplasticity. Mindfulness involves paying focused attention to the present moment and can help strengthen areas of the brain related to attention, emotional regulation, and memory (Zeidan et al., 2010). As part of a digital detox, mindfulness exercises such as meditation, deep breathing, and journaling can help retrain the brain to focus more effectively and reduce the stress associated with constant digital distractions.
The Stress Response and Cortisol
Another critical factor in understanding the benefits of digital detoxing is the role of stress in brain function. Chronic overstimulation from digital devices can elevate levels of cortisol, the body’s primary stress hormone. Elevated cortisol levels can interfere with cognitive function, impair memory, and contribute to feelings of anxiety and irritability (Lupien et al., 2009).
Taking a break from digital screens allows the body to rest and recover from the constant stressors that digital engagement can create. By reducing exposure to digital stimuli, individuals can lower cortisol levels and activate the body’s parasympathetic nervous system, which is responsible for promoting relaxation and recovery. As a result, the body and mind can return to a state of balance, enhancing both mental and physical well-being.
The Benefits of Digital Detoxing
While the effects of digital detoxing may vary from person to person, there are several well-documented benefits that individuals may experience when they reduce their screen time. These include improvements in mental clarity, emotional regulation, productivity, and sleep quality.
1. Improved Mental Clarity and Focus
One of the most immediate benefits of a digital detox is the restoration of mental clarity. Without the constant influx of digital information, the brain can more effectively focus on the task at hand. This is particularly beneficial for individuals who struggle with distractions and find it difficult to concentrate for long periods. By taking a break from digital devices, individuals can improve their attention span and engage more deeply in tasks, leading to enhanced productivity and creativity.
2. Reduced Stress and Anxiety
A digital detox can lead to a noticeable reduction in stress and anxiety levels. Constant exposure to digital stimuli—particularly from social media, work emails, and news updates—can increase feelings of overwhelm and contribute to mental fatigue. Disconnecting from these sources of stress allows individuals to recharge and return to a state of emotional balance. Studies have shown that taking regular breaks from technology can help regulate the body’s stress response and improve overall emotional well-being (Pikhartova et al., 2014).
3. Better Sleep Quality
Another significant benefit of digital detoxing is improved sleep. The blue light emitted by digital screens has been shown to interfere with the production of melatonin, the hormone that regulates sleep. This can lead to difficulties falling asleep and staying asleep, particularly if devices are used late at night. By reducing screen time, especially before bed, individuals can improve their sleep hygiene and achieve more restful, restorative sleep.
Practical Strategies for Digital Detoxing
While the idea of disconnecting from digital devices may seem daunting, there are several practical strategies that can help individuals gradually integrate a digital detox into their daily lives.
1. Set Boundaries for Screen Time
One of the most straightforward ways to begin a digital detox is to set clear boundaries for screen time. This can involve limiting the use of certain devices, such as smartphones or computers, during specific times of the day. For example, individuals can designate certain hours in the evening as “screen-free” to avoid unnecessary digital engagement before bedtime.
2. Schedule Tech-Free Days or Weekends
For a more extended digital detox, individuals can schedule entire days or weekends without screens. During this time, individuals can focus on offline activities such as reading, outdoor exercise, cooking, or spending quality time with family and friends. These digital-free days provide an opportunity to reset the mind and regain perspective on life beyond technology.
3. Practice Mindfulness and Meditation
Mindfulness practices, including meditation, deep breathing, and journaling, are excellent ways to complement a digital detox. These activities help individuals reconnect with the present moment and reduce the mental clutter associated with constant digital engagement. Meditation, in particular, has been shown to enhance neuroplasticity, improve emotional regulation, and promote relaxation.
4. Implement Technology-Free Zones
Creating designated “technology-free zones” in the home can also promote a digital detox. For example, individuals can designate the bedroom or dining room as a space where screens are not allowed. This helps create boundaries between work, leisure, and personal time, encouraging individuals to engage more meaningfully with their environment and the people around them.
